Прескочи към информацията за продукта
1 от 1

Ниски наличности: остават 1

SKU:140144

Антикварен магазин - Нешев Колекшън

Въведение в програмирането с Java

Въведение в програмирането с Java

Обичайна цена €37,30 EUR
Обичайна цена Цена при разпродажба €37,30 EUR
Разпродажба Изчерпано
С включени данъци. Доставката се изчислява при плащане.
Количество

Добре дошли в „Въведение в програмирането с Java“ — практичен курс, който превръща търсенето на първите стъпки в софтуерната разработка в сигурна основа. Насочен към абсолютни начинаещи, този курс ви води от простата синтаксиска идея до изграждането на реални Java приложения, без излишна сложност и с ясно обяснени концепции.

За кого е подходящ курсът

  • Студенти и нови програмисти, които искат да започнат с ясна и логична база по Java.
  • Хора, преминаващи към софтуерна кариера и търсещи солидна основа в обектно-ориентираното програмиране.
  • Техники и хобисти, които искат да създават портфолио от малки, работещи приложения на Java.

Какво ще научите

  • Основи на Java: синтаксис, променливи и типове данни, операторы, цикли и условни структури.
  • Обектно-ориентирано програмиране в Java: класове, обекти, конструктори, наследяване, полиморфизъм и интерфейси.
  • Работа с колекции, обработка на потоци и основи на функционалното програмиране в Java.
  • Управление на изключения и устойчивост на кода, за да се справяте с неочаквани ситуации по време на изпълнение.
  • Създаване на конзолни приложения и основи на работата с файлове за вход/изход.
  • Среда за разработка и инструментариум: настройка на Java среда, използване на IDE (напр. IntelliJ IDEA), както и Maven/Gradle за управление на зависимости и сборки.
  • Път към по-сложни теми: JVM архитектура, как работят програмите на Java и как да ги оптимизирате за по-добра производителност.

Практически проекти и упражнения

  • Конзолно приложение като калкулатор за основни операции (снабдено с валидация на входа и ясноно съобщения за грешки).
  • Система за управление на задачи (To-Do списък) с използване на колекции и базова логика за филтриране и сортиране.
  • Минимальна банка сметка: базово портфолио за дебит/кредит, баланс и прости транзакции, за да видите как данните се моделират в обектите.
  • Дебъгване и тестове: как да откривате проблеми, да използвате точките на прекъсване и да пишете прости тестове за основни функции.

Защо Java и това обучение са различни

  • Практически подход: всеки концепт идва с конкретен пример и работещ код, за да видите как теорията се превръща в реална функционалност.
  • Фокус върху първата реална употреба: от самото начало изграждате не просто теории, а знания, които можете веднага да приложите в мини-проекти.
  • Стъпка по стъпка изграждане на умения: от базов синтаксис към обектно-ориентиране и работа с файлове и данни, без да се изисква предишен опит.
  • Разбиране на контекста: как работи JVM и защо Java е крос-платформена технология, което ви помага да предвиждате как кодът ще се държи в различни среди.

Какви резултати да очаквате

След завършване на курса ще може да:

  • самостоятелно да пишете чист и работещ Java код, използвайки основни и средно напреднали конструкции;
  • архитектурирайте прости обектно-ориентирани решения, моделирайки реални предметни области (като задачи, финанси или управление на данни);
  • да разбирате и използвате стандартни инструменти за разработка и управление на проекта (IDE, билд системи);
  • да подготвите база за по-сложни теми като джънкшън, многопоточност и бази данни в Java в следващ етап на обучението.

Какво прави курса уникален за вас

  • Ясна структура, която съпровожда от първия ред код към конкретни проекти и решения на реални задачи.
  • Доказани подходи за учене на програмиране: систематично обяснение на концепциите и практическо приложение чрез код.
  • Инструментална готовност: освен знания за Java, ще придобиете умения за работа с полезни инструменти, които се използват в реалните проекти.

Как да започнете

Просто започнете да пишете и експериментирате с примерен код, като следвате стъпките и задачите в курса. Прогресивното разгръщане на материалите ви дава яснота какво е следващото, което трябва да научите, за да преминете към по-сложни концепции и проекти.

Състояние: Много добро

Произход: Български

Корица: Мека

Страници: 905

Език: Български

Издателство: Software University

Година: 2008

Автор: Колектив

Забележки:

Покажи пълните подробности